Part 2: Create a blank Venue Condition Assessment form, using th‌‍‍‍‍‌‌‌‌‌‍‍‌‌‍‍‍‍‍‍e Microsoft Excel spreadsheet provided. A VCA form is a record that allows the assessed condition of a venue to be measured. Its format is open to interpretation, however, a standard format may include; • A table or spreadsheet in landscape format. • A vertical menu on the left hand side that covers critical components of the venue. Section headings may include, for example, structure, fixtures and fittings, equipment, services. Details of each section should then be listed. • A horizontal menu across the top will list how the venue will be assessed / evaluated and must include at least one theoretical framework.
